Target data

Function

Ubiquitous endoprotease within constitutive secretory pathways capable of cleavage at the RX(K/R)R consensus motif (PubMed:11799113, PubMed:1629222, PubMed:1713771, PubMed:2251280, PubMed:24666235, PubMed:25974265, PubMed:7592877, PubMed:7690548, PubMed:9130696). Mediates processing of TGFB1, an essential step in TGF-beta-1 activation (PubMed:7737999). Converts through proteolytic cleavage the non-functional Brain natriuretic factor prohormone into its active hormone BNP(1-32) (PubMed:20489134, PubMed:21763278). By mediating processing of accessory subunit ATP6AP1/Ac45 of the V-ATPase, regulates the acidification of dense-core secretory granules in islets of Langerhans cells (By similarity). (Microbial infection) Cleaves and activates diphtheria toxin DT. (Microbial infection) Cleaves and activates anthrax toxin protective antigen (PA). (Microbial infection) Cleaves and activates HIV-1 virus Envelope glycoprotein gp160. (Microbial infection) Required for H7N1 and H5N1 influenza virus infection probably by cleaving hemagglutinin. (Microbial infection) Able to cleave S.pneumoniae serine-rich repeat protein PsrP. (Microbial infection) Facilitates human coronaviruses EMC and SARS-CoV-2 infections by proteolytically cleaving the spike protein at the monobasic S1/S2 cleavage site. This cleavage is essential for spike protein-mediated cell-cell fusion and entry into human lung cells. (Microbial infection) Facilitates mumps virus infection by proteolytically cleaving the viral fusion protein F.

What are recombinant multiclonals?
Recombinant multiclonals are a mixture of recombinant antibodies co-expressed from a library of heavy and light chains. They offer several advantages including:

  • - The sensitivity of polyclonal antibodies by recognising multiple epitopes
  • - High batch-to-batch consistency and reproducibility
  • - Improved sensitivity and specificity
  • - Long-term security of supply
  • - Animal-free batch production

    FURIN Flow Cytometry (Intracellular) staining using rabbit Anti-FURIN antibody

    Flow cytometric analysis of 4% paraformaldehyde fixed 90% methanol permeabilized K-562 (human chronic myelogenous leukemia lymphoblast) (Right) / Ramos (human Burkitt's lymphoma B lymphocyte) (Left) cells labelling FURIN with ab324440 at 1/50 dilution (1ug) (Red) compared with a Rabbit monoclonal IgG (Rabbit IgG, monoclonal [EPR25A] - Isotype Control ab172730) (Black) isotype control and an unlabelled control (cells without incubation with primary antibody and secondary antibody).

    Goat Anti-Rabbit IgG (Alexa Fluor® 488,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) preadsorbed ab150081) at 1/5000 dilution was used as the secondary antibody.

    Low expression: Ramos.

    FURIN Immunocytochemistry/ Immunofluorescence staining using rabbit Anti-FURIN antibody

    Immunofluorescent analysis of 4% Paraformaldehyde-fixed, 0.1% TritonX-100 permeabilized K-562 (human chronic myelogenous leukemia lymphoblast) cells labelling FURIN with ab324440 at 1/50 (10.0 ug/ml) dilution, followed by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) preadsorbed ab150081 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) preadsorbed antibody at 1/1000 dilution (Green).

    Confocal image showing cytoplasmic staining in K-562 and no staining in Ramos cell line (shown in green). The counterstain was observed in magenta. Nuclear DNA was labelled with DAPI (shown in blue).

    Low expression: Ramos.

    Image was taken with a confocal microscope (Leica-Microsystems, TCS SP8).

    Alexa Fluor® 594 Anti-alpha Tubulin antibody [DM1A] - Microtubule Marker ab195889 Anti-alpha Tubulin mouse monoclonal antibody - Microtubule Marker (Alexa Fluor® 594) was used to counterstain tubulin at 1/200 dilution (Magenta). The Nuclear counterstain was DAPI (Blue).

    Secondary antibody only control: Secondary antibody is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) preadsorbed ab150081 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) preadsorbed at 1/1000 dilution.
